Centos
什么是centos
CentOS是基于Linux内核的100%免费的操作系统,多用于服务器系统,CentOS的存在是为了提供一个免费的企业级计算平台,并努力与其上游源Red Hat保持100%的二进制兼容性。
Centos长什么样子
其实 Linux 系统也是有可视化界面的,但是如果我们使用可视化的界面去使用 Linux 系统,那这与使用 Windows 就没有什么区别了,Linux 系统的操作命令正是它的魅力所在。
如果你想知道它到底长什么样子,可以去敲一些命令,观察你的 CentOS 系统。
Centos系统的基本操作命令
1、pwd :查看自己当前在哪个目录下;
2、cd /:进入本系统的根目录下(相当于你打开windows系统,点击计算机的操作)
3、、 ls:查看根目录下的内容(就是查看 windows 的 C盘D盘等文件)
4、查看系统版本: cat /etc/centos-release
5、系统更新: yum update
6、查看内核版本号:uname -r
7、查看操作系统位数:getconf LONG_BIT
ssh
ssh是什么
“SSH 为 Secure Shell 的缩写,由 IETF 的网络小组(Network Working Group)所制定;SSH 为建立在应用层基础上的安全协议。SSH 是目前较可靠,专为远程登录会话和其他网络服务提供安全性的协议。
ssh的简单用法
1、SSH主要用于远程登录
假定你要以用户名username,登录到远程主机host,只需要一条简单命令就可以了。
$ ssh username@host
如果本地用户名与远程用户名一致,登录时可以省略用户名。
$ ssh host
SSH的默认端口是22,也就是说,你的登录请求会送进远程主机的22端口。使用p参数,可以修改这个端口。
$ ssh -p 1058 username@host
上面这条命令表示,ssh直接连接远程主机的1058端口。
2、客户端与远程主机的安全链接
命令如下:$ ssh -p 2222 user@host
解释如下:
-p 2222 :指定端口号2222
user :登陆用户名
host ;远程主机地址
安全链接的过程是:
1).远程主机端收到客户端的登陆请求时先发送自己的公钥给客户端
2).客户端用拿到的公钥加密用户名和密码,然后发送给远程主机
3).远程主机用自己的密钥解密收到的用户名和密码,然后校验用户名和密码是否正确,如果正确则登陆成功。
在链接的过程中会有如下信息
$ ssh user@host
The authenticity of host 'host (12.18.429.21)' can't be established.
RSA key fingerprint is 98:2e:d7:e0:de:9f:ac:67:28:c2:42:2d:37:16:58:4d.
Are you sure you want to continue connecting (yes/no)?
链接: [link]https://www.cnblogs.com/one-tom/p/10712045.html
来源:CSDN
作者:qq_42329972
链接:https://blog.csdn.net/qq_42329972/article/details/103604438